Hi Andrew, On Thu, 2012-05-17 at 15:32 -0500, Andrew Bogott wrote: > I would appreciate comments on the nascent Nova plugin framework > that I'm working on. My Nova code is in a fairly modern forked branch here: > > https://github.com/andrewbogott/nova/tree/plugin > > I've also written two example plugins, which live here: > > https://github.com/andrewbogott/novawikiplugins > > The two plugins in that repo implement actual features that we need > here at Wikimedia Labs -- One of them is an implementation of shared > volumes similar to the one I presented at the design summit.
This isn't so much of a comment on your plugin work, but do those two plugins make sense as plugins? - I'd love to see a "Filesystems as a Service" service in OpenStack similar to Cinder. Wouldn't it make more sense as a new service? - The wikistatus plugin uses notifications; why can't it be external to nova and pull notifications from the message bus?
